Php 贝宝交易可以包括第三方吗?

Php 贝宝交易可以包括第三方吗?,php,web-services,paypal,finance,currency,Php,Web Services,Paypal,Finance,Currency,情况如下:有一个网站可以连接卖家和买家,比如Ebay 除其他事项外,网站所有者需要知道从那里初始化的每笔交易的详细信息。本质上,我正在寻找一种支付方式,返回一个数字收据 有可能用贝宝做这样的事情吗?这与贝宝无关。您需要以自己的代码通知此“市场网站” 是的,这是可能的。当然你可以这样做 您必须做以下几件事: 让卖家注册他们的贝宝信息。比如在“卖家”表中,以商户电子邮件/商户id作为主键 卖家必须在他们的PayPal帐户上设置IPN URL。该url必须指向您将创建的IPN处理程序 处理IPN,看看

情况如下:有一个网站可以连接卖家和买家,比如Ebay

除其他事项外,网站所有者需要知道从那里初始化的每笔交易的详细信息。本质上,我正在寻找一种支付方式,返回一个数字收据


有可能用贝宝做这样的事情吗?

这与贝宝无关。您需要以自己的代码通知此“市场网站”


是的,这是可能的。

当然你可以这样做

您必须做以下几件事:

  • 让卖家注册他们的贝宝信息。比如在“卖家”表中,以商户电子邮件/商户id作为主键
  • 卖家必须在他们的PayPal帐户上设置IPN URL。该url必须指向您将创建的IPN处理程序
  • 处理IPN,看看这个。不久前,我为Joomla编写了PayPal IPN处理程序,您可以随时修改它并根据需要使用它(您必须从配置中删除商户信息)。这里还有一个您将收到的IPN VAR列表
  • 如果IPN良好,在处理IPN时,检查接收方电子邮件和/或接收方id,以确定谁是卖方。您可以通过电子邮件/Merchanage\u id从“sellers”表中检索卖家信息。此时,您可以向卖家/买家/您自己/等生成各种通知 注意事项:

    • 如果非主要PayPal用户将创建PayPal按钮,您将无法使用商户ID
    • IPN变量列表将取决于付款类型和提交方式
    • 始终使用

    嗨,布拉德,我不确定你是否理解我问题的意图。也许我说得太含糊了。我没有意识到,当网站知道卖家的贝宝ID时,付款从哪里开始就无关紧要了。我需要的关键字是“Express Checkout”。@johndoo-这就是为什么我在开始评论时使用了它,如果在数组对象实例上使用它,将导致问题。